  6. Winner of the PARENTS MAGAZINE GOLD MEDAL My Side Of The Mountain, based on the book by Jean George, is the unique adventure of thirteen-year-old Sam Gribley. Sam's hero is naturalist poet Henry David Thoreau, so Sam writes a note to his folks, packs up and leaves home for the challenge of wilderness living.

  7. Sam, a brilliant child, leaves home for the mountains after being told that the family summer trip has been canceled, thus preventing him from doing the algae experiments he had planned for that summer. The film chronicles his struggle for independence, and with the forces of natures.
